PERANCANGAN SISTEM INFORMASI BIMBINGAN BELAJAR SOLUSI PRIMA NGEMPLAK SLEMAN BERBASIS WEB
NASKAH PUBLIKASI
diajukan oleh Andhika Hendri Saputra 10.11.4435
kepada JURUSAN TEKNIK INFORMATIKA SEKOLAH TINGGI MANAJEMEN INFORMATIKA DAN KOMPUTER AMIKOM YOGYAKARTA YOGYAKARTA 2014
DESIGN STUDY GUIDANCE INFORMATION SYSTEM SOLUSI PRIM NGEMPLAK SLEMAN WEB BASED PERANCANGAN SISTEM INFORMASI BIMBINGAN BELAJAR SOLUSI PRIMA NGEMPLAK SLEMAN BERBASIS WEB Andhika Hendri Saputra Erik Hadi Saputra Jurusan Teknik Informatika STMIK AMIKOM YOGYAKARTA ABSTRACT The main task of a LEARNING MENTORING provide services especially in the field of education to people in need, providing assistance in the form of learning to the fullest, handling of reports or documentation, handling administration, according to the rules and regulations that have been determined. Problems that exist in the Solusi Prima Tutoring is still providing services in the form of a manual process that is all manual recording and documenting reports are recorded in the document. Therefore, the project is about the development of information systems in a computer database so that the data reports and documents can be better organized with the use of highly efficient and can be developed that can be integrated and diberdayagunakan to the development of the system conducted by the human resources and documentation will be easier if data needed as a further reference. Besides designing an application, the information system can also help in the search for efficiency in the search for documents storage and can be used as a reference and can be developed. Keyword : study guidance, information system
1.
PENDAHULUAN Dewasa ini pemerintah menghadapi berbagai kendala dalam rangka peningkatan
mutu pendidikan. Keberhasilan mutu pendidikan sangat tergantung dari keberhasilan proses belajar mengajar yang merupakan sinergi dari komponen-komponen pendidikan baik kurikulum tenaga pendidikan, sarana prasarana, sistem pengelolaan, maupun berupa faktor lingkungan alamiah dan lingkungan sosial, dengan peserta didik sebagai subyeknya. Proses belajar mengajar sebagai sistem dipengaruhi oleh berbagai faktor. Salah satunya adalah guru yang merupakan pelaksana utama pendidikan di lapangan. Kualitas guru baik kualitas akademik maupun non akademik juga ikut mempengaruhi kualitas pembelajaran. Faktor lainnya yang tak kalah pentingnya dalam menentukan keberhasilan kegiatan belajar mengajar adalah sumber belajar. Dalam rangka mengupayakan peningkatan kualitas program pembelajaran perlu dilandasi dengan pandangan sistematik terhadap kegiatan belajar mengajar yang juga harus didukung dengan upaya pendayagunaan sumber belajar di antaranya adalah bimbingan belajar. Sebuah bimbingan belajar hendaknya mempunyai sebuah sistem yang digunakan untuk mengolah data dan pembukuan data, agar apabila dilain kesempatan ingin menggunakan kembali atau mencari suatu data tidak kesulitan. Apalagi di era modern sekarang ini banyak alat yang canggih, praktis, dan efisien yang dapat dipergunakan, misalnya komputer. Oleh karena itu untuk membantu penyimpanan data, diperlukan sistem penyimpanan yang baik dan efisien. Dengan memanfaatkan kemajuan teknologi maka dibangun sistem informasi bimbingan belajar berbasis web yang menampilkan suatu informasi bimbingan belajar yang dapat diakses via komputer dengan format yang telah ditentukan. Dengan adanya sistem ini maka admin mendapat kemudahan dalam mengolah semua data yang berhubungan dengan kegiatan belajar, serta dokumendokumen milik lembaga bimbingan belajar. Berdasarkan latar belakang masalah yang ada maka penulis mengambil sebuah judul “Perancangan Sistem Informasi Bimbingan Belajar Solusi Prima Ngemplak Sleman Berbasis Web” yang diharapkan nantinya akan memberikan manfaat yang besar dan berguna untuk proses kegiatan di Solusi Prima Bimbel. 2.
LANDASAN TEORI 1. 2. 1. 2.
2.1
Konsep Dasar Sistem Informasi
2.1 Pengertian Sistem Informasi
Sistem merupakan suatu kumpulan atau himpunan dari unsur atau variable variable yang saling terorganisasi, saling berinteraksi, dan saling bergantung sama lain.Sementara informasi adalah data yang telah diolah menjadi bentuk yang lebih berarti bagi penerimanya dan bermanfaat dalam pengambilan keputusan saat ini atau mendatang1
3
Tipe Sistem Informasi
Dalam sistem informasi terbagi menjadi beberapa tipe sesuai dengan kebutuhan dan kegunaanya.Masing-masing mempunyai cara dan penggunaan yang berbeda. Tipe Sistem Infomasi dibedakan menjadi beberapa tipe,diantaranya: 1. 2. 3. 4.
Transaction Processing System (TPS) Management Information System (MIS) Decision Support System (DSS) Expert System and Artificial Intelleigence (ES & AI) 3.1.1
Komponen Sistem Informasi
Stair (1992) menjelaskan bahwa sistem informasi berbasis komputer (CBIS) alam suatu organisasi terdiri dari komponen-komponen berikut: 1.
Perangkat keras, yaitu perangkat keras komponen untuk melengkapi kegiatan memasukan data, memproses data dan keluaran data.
2.
Perangkat lunak, yaitu program dan intruksi yang diberikan ke komputer.
3.
Database, yaitu kumpulan data dan informasi yang diorganisasikan sedemikian rupa sehingga mudah diakses pengguna sistem informasi.
4.
Telekomunikasi, yaitu komunikasi yang menghubungkan antara pengguna sistem dengan sistem komputer secara bersama-sama ke dalam suatu jaringan kerja yang efektif.
5.
Manusia, yaitu personal dari sistem informasi, meliputi manajer analis, programmer dan operator serta bertanggungjawab terhadap perawatan sistem.
6.
Prosedur, yakni tata cara yang meliputi strategi, kebijakan, metode dan peraturanperaturan dalam menggunakan sistem informasi berbasis komputer.2
3.
Bimbingan Belajar Sebagai salah satu bagian yang penting dalam pencapaian tujuan pendidikan,
bimbingan terus menerus berupaya memapankan eksistensinya. Bimbingan sering diartikan sebagai proses pemberian bantuan kepada individu atau kelompok agar mampu memahami diri dan lingkungannya. Tujuan utamanya adalah perkembangan optimal,
1
Al Fatta, Hanif.2007.Analisis & Perancangan Sistem Informasi. Hal 9
2
Al Fatta, Hanif., Analisis & Perancangan Sistem Informasi, (2007), Andi Yogyakarta. Hal.10-11
yaitu perkembangan yang sesuai dengan potensi serta sistem nilai tentang kehidupan yang baik dan benar. 3 bimbingan adalah proses pemberian bantuan kepada individu ataupun sekelompok individu secara berkesinambungan dan terprogram yang dilakukan oleh guru pembimbing agar mereka menjadi pribadi yang mandiri. Sedangkan belajar memiliki makna sebuah proses dari individu dan masyarakat dalam memperoleh berbagai kecakapan, keterampilan, dan sikap. 4 Jadi bimbingan belajar adalah suatu bentuk kegiatan dalam proses belajar yang dilakukan oleh seseorang yang telah memiliki kemampuan lebih dalam banyak hal untuk diberikan kepada orang lain yang mana bertujuan agar orang lain dapat menemukan pengetahuan baru yang belum dimilikinya serta dapat diterapkan dalam kehidupannya. 3.
ANALISIS DAN PERANCANGAN SISTEM
5.
Gambaran Umum Solusi Prima Bimbel Bimbingan belajar (Bimbel) Solusi Prima adalah sebuah program bimbingan
belajar yang ditujukan untuk meningkatkan prestasi siswa dalam ujian semester maupun ujian Nasional (Unas) yang beralamat di Kabunan, Widodomartani, Ngemplak, Sleman, Yogyakarta. Dengan staf pengajarnya yang berasal dari perguruan tinggi negeri ternama seperti Universitas Negeri Yogyakarta, UIN Yogyakarta, Sanata Darma , serta Universitas Ahmad Dahlan. Bimbel Solusi Prima memberikan solusi yang berkualitas dan terjamin untuk peningkatan studi siswa-siswinya. Bimbingan belajar Solusi Prima berdiri sejak tahun 2005 yang didirikan dengan tujuan untuk meningkatkan prestasi para siswa yang kebanyakan para orang tua mereka sibuk bekerja sehingga memiliki sedikit waktu untuk mendampingi anaknya dalam belajar. Dibekali dengan kemampuan akademis serta dedikasi yang tinggi untuk meningkatkan prestasi akademis siswa, maka muncul ide untuk memberikan tambahan pelajaran atau bimbingan belajar bagi siswa. Mulanya kegiatan ini hanya untuk memberikan pendampingan untuk tetangga sekitar. Ternyata ada siswa yang mampu mendapatkan nilai yang lebih baik dan mendapatkan ranking minimal 3 besar di kelasnya. Belajar
dari
keberhasilan
tersebut
dan
makin
banyaknya
permintaan
pendampingan belajar dari warga luar dusun Kabunan, muncullah ide untuk mendirikan sebuah bimbingan belajar. Solusi Prima mulai memekarkan sayapnya dengan membuka kesempatan bagi para siswa SD, SMP, dan juga tingkat SMA untuk ikut belajar bersama
3
Yusuf, Syamsu dan Nurihsan, Juntika. 2005. Landasan Bimbingan & Konseling, Bandung: PT.
Remaja Rosdakarya. 4
Gredler, Margaret E Bell. 1991. Belajar dan Membelajarkan, Jakarta: Rajawali.
guna membantu kesulitan-kesulitan belajar yang dihadapi di sekolah dan meningkatkan prestasinya.
3.1.1 Visi Solusi Prima Bimbel Visi adalah satu gambaran masa depan yang akan diwujudkan oleh Solusi Prima, yakni berupa gambaran sebagai hasil dari suatu pemikiran bersama yang melampaui realitas sekarang, serta suatu keadaan yang ingin diciptakan dimasa depan. Yaitu unggul dalam prestasi, berbudi pekerti luhur dan berwawasan lingkungan.
3.1.2 Misi Solusi Prima Bimbel Misi merupakan pilihan atau cara yang dipilih untuk menuju ke masa yang akan datang dalam rangka merealisasikan Visi dari Solusi Prima. Antara lain: 1.
Melaksanakan kegiatan belajar-mengajar secara efektif untuk mencapai prestasi
2. 3.
yang optimal Menumbuhkan semangat keunggulan terhadap siswa Mendorong membantu setiap siswa untuk mengenali potensi (dirinya) sehingga dapat berkembang secara optimal.
6.
Analisis Sistem Analisis sistem merupakan bagian yang sangat penting dalam dalam siklus
pengembangan sebuah sistem. Dalam analisis sistem ini menguraikan bagian-bagian komponen yang nantinya akan bekerja untuk mencapai tujuan dari system tersebut. Semua hal menjadi masalah ataupun kelemahan dari sistem yang lama akan dijabarkan dalam bagian ini. Hal ini akan sangat membantu dalam pengembangan sistem karena hal-hal yang mejadi pokok permasalahan akan dianalisa dan kemudian akan dibuat sebuah gambaran secara spesifik bagaimana sistem yang baru akan dibuat sehingga sistem yang baru dapat mengatasi masalah ataupun kelemahan dari sistem lama yang telah ada. Perencanaan sistem baru yang akan dibuat mulai dari apa saja komponenkomponen yang mendukung sistem baru kemudian analisis terhadap kelayakan sistem baru akan menguatkan apakah sistem yang akan dibuat termasuk dalam kategori layak ataupun tidak. Dalam tahap analisis sistem ini menggunakan beberapa tahapan analsis yangakan dilakukan, tahapan itu meliputi: identifikasi masalah, analisis kelemahan sistem, analisis kebutuhan sistem dan analisis kelayakan sistem.
6.1
Perancangan Sistem Perancangan sistem secara umum merupakan tahap persiapan dari rancangan
secara rinci terhadap sistem baru yang akan diterapkan.
Rancangan sistem secara
umum dilakukan dengan tujuan untuk memberikan gambaran secara umum kepada pengguna.
3.3.1
Perancangan Flowchart
Gambar Flowchart
5
3.3.2
Perancangan diagram konteks
Gambar Diagram Konteks
6
3.3.3
Perancangan DFD
Gambar DFD 4.
IMPLEMENTASI DAN PEMBAHASAN
8.
Tahap Implementasi Sistem Instalai sistem bimbingan belajar kedalam web server setelah penginstalan xampp
selesai. Penginstalan sistem dengan cara menempatkan file-file sistem kedalam folder webserver yaitu dalam folder htdoc. Buat folder sistem dalam folder htdoc dengan nama prima. Kemudian tempatkan file-file sistem dalam folder prima.
7
Gambar Folder Dalam XAMPP
Gambar Folder Dalam htdocs 9.
Tindak Lanjut Implementasi Tindak lanjut implentasi adalah tahapan yang dilakukan untuk pemeliharaan sistem
baru agar sistem baru yang dijalankan dapat berjalan dengan baik. Pemeliharaan yang dilakukan diantaranya pemeliharaan software dan hardware
8
4
Pemeliharaan Software Pemeliharaan software ditujukan agar kinerja dari sistem dapat berjalan dengan
maksimal. Pemeliharaan yang dilakukan terbagi menjadi 2 bagian yaitu pemeliharaan terhadapap sistem dan pemeliharaan terhadap data-data yang ada. a.
Pemeliharaan Sistem Pemeliharaan sistem sangatlah penting karena sistem yang telah dibuat
penggunaannya tidak dapat menghindari sebuah kesalahan ataupun tuntutan untuk merubah sesuai dengan kebutuhan yang akan datang. Hal ini dilakukan agar sistem yang berjalan dapat terus berjalan dan dapat mendukung proses yang dilakukan. Hal - hal yang harus diperhatikan dalam perubahan sistem yaitu : a. Masalah-masalah yang akan muncul di kemudian hari. b. Kebutuhan akan hal yang baru dalam sistem
untuk
menunjang
keberlangsungan sistem. c. Tuntutan akan perubahan proses bisnis yang berjalan. d. Tuntutan akan perubahan untuk penerapan teknologi baru. e. Desain sistem baru yang dikarenakan berbagai macam alasan. Pemeliharaan Data
b.
Keberadaan sebuah data-data dalam suatu sistem informasi merupakan hal terpenting mengingat semua informasi dalam layanan sistem akan ditampung dan disimpan
dalam
database.
Pengamanan
menjadi
hal
sangat
prioritas
untuk
dipertimbangkan. Dalam sistem ini database haruslah dibackup secara rutin karena datadata berada dalam database. Backup database dapat dilakukan dengan export database dari phpmyadmin. Backup data secara mencetak sebagai arsip juga menjadi cara untuk memelihara data yang ada agar tidak hilang ataupun rusak. 5
Pemeliharaan Hardware Berikut ini adalah langkah-langkah yang dilakukan dalam melakukan perawatan
perangkat keras: a. Memperhatikan kebersihan komputer, yaitu dengan cara melakukan pembersihan perangkat keras komputer secara berkala. b. Menjaga tegangan listrik, hal ini dapat dilakukan dengan pemasangan stabiliser pada perangkat komputer. c. Mematikan komputer dengan tahapan yang benar melalui sistem operasi (shut down). d. Memperhatikan suhu komputer, hal ini dapat dibantu dengan memasang kipas pada perangkat komputer dan pengecekan pendingin processor secara berkala. 10.
Pembahasan
9
Pembahasan terhadap sistem yang telah dibuat dititik beratkan pada basis data. Basis data yang menjadi pokok dari bimbingan belajar ini menjadi hal yang mendasar agar sistem dapat berjalan dengan baik. Basis data pada bimbingan belajar ini menjadi hal yang paling riskan karena menjadi inti dari keberlangsungan kegiatan bimbingan belajar. Pada basis data ini pembahasan yang dilakukan dititik beratkan pada jenis-jenis transaksi yang dilakukan khususnya untuk transaksi uang masuk ataupun uang keluar. Kelebihan dari aplikasi ini memiliki sistem keamanan yang mengenkripsi password dan dengan adanya aplikasi ini admin dapat mencari data yang mereka inginkan tanpa harus mencari dalam buku yang ada drak, cukup dengan input keyword kemudian eksekusi. Serta aplikasi ini dilengkapi dengan perintah cetak laporan. Sistem ini masih mempunyai kekurangan, kekurangan dari aplikasi bimbingan belajar ini adalahh Sistem ini hanya dapat diakses dalam server local seperti localhost dan belum tersedianya proses backup dan restore data 5.
KESIMPULAN Pada bagian terakhir ini penulis mencoba menyimpulkan yang berdasarkan
penelitian dan pembuatan sistem informasi bimbingan belajar Solusi Prima Ngemplak Sleman. Kesimpulan yang didapat diuraikan sebagia berikut ini: 1. Dalam perancangan dan pembuatan sistem informasi bimbingan belajar Solusi Prima dibuat dengan teknologi web dengan bahasa pemrograman PHP dan basis data dengan Mysql.
Dalam hal apa saja yang dibuat dalam sistem informasi
bimbingan belajar maka dapat diuraikan sebagai berikut: a. Fungsi-fungsi menambah data, mengubah data dan melihat data dapat berjalan dengan baik begitu juga dengan pencarian data dapat berjalan dengan baik. b. Keamanan sistem yang baru memungkinkan pengguna yang hanya di beri otoritas yang dapat masuk ke dalam sistem. 2. Laporan keuangan yang sebagai hasil dari sistem informasi ini dapat memenuhi kebutuhan yang dibutuhkan. Laporan keuangan dapat dibuat secara otomatis oleh sistem dengan mengolah data-data yang telah dimasukkan dengan proses yang telah dibuat dalam sistem. Laporan yang dibuat telah sesuai dengan apa yang direkomdasikan dari pihak Solusi Prima. Pembuatan laporan yang membutuhkan
waktu
hanya
dalam
hitungan
detik
diharapkan
dapat
meningkatkan pelayanan dan kinerja dari bimbingan belajar Solusi Prima. 3. Sistem
informasi
bimbingan
belajar
berbasis
web
ini
sudah
mampu
meningkatkan kemampuan daan pengelolaan data dengan cepat, data yang dikelolapun lengkap, sehingga dapat menghasilkan data yang relevan. 4. Sistem informasi ini kinerjanya lebih teliti di bandingan dengan kegiatan manual 10
sehingga kebenaran dan kesesuaian data lebih terjamin
11
DAFTAR PUSTAKA Al Fatta, Hanif. 2007. Analisis & Perancangan Sistem Informasi. Yogyakarta: Andi Offset. Gredler, Margaret E Bell. 1991. Belajar dan Membelajarkan, Jakarta: Rajawali. Sunyoto,
Andi,
M.Kom.
2007.
AJAX
Membangun
Web
dengan
Teknologi
ASYNCHRONOUSE JavaScript & XML. Yogyakarta: Andi Offset. Yusuf, Syamsu dan Nurihsan, Juntika. 2005. Landasan Bimbingan & Konseling, Bandung: PT. Remaja Rosdakarya.